Public relations PR is the practice of managing and disseminating information from an individual or an organization such as a business government agency or a nonprofit organization to the public in order to affect their public perceptionPublic relations PR and publicity differ in that PR is controlled internally whereas publicity is not controlled and contributed by external. A conflict of interest COI is a situation in which a person or organization is involved in multiple interests financial or otherwise and serving one interest could involve working against another. Typically this relates to situations in which the personal interest of an individual or organization might adversely affect a duty owed to make decisions for the benefit of a third party.
